P. Venkataramaniah Vs Assistant Commissioner ST (Andhra Pradesh High Court)

The Andhra Pradesh High Court heard a writ petition filed by a partnership firm engaged in providing work contract services to various Government departments. The petitioner, a registered GST assessee, challenged the assessment order dated 31.08.2024 passed by the fourth respondent for the tax periods 2018-2019 to 2021-2022.

The petitioner contended that the impugned assessment order, which covered multiple tax periods through a single composite order, was impermissible under the provisions of the Central Goods and Services Tax Act. In support of this contention, the petitioner relied upon the decision of a co-ordinate Bench of the Andhra Pradesh High Court in S.J. Constructions v. The Assistant Commissioner & Others (W.P No.11028 of 2025 & batch), dated 17.09.2025.

The petitioner referred to the findings in that decision, wherein the Court had held that Section 74(3) is pari materia with Section 73(3), and although Section 74(4) does not use the expression “such tax period”, that omission does not alter the interpretation. The co-ordinate Bench had further observed that permitting a single show cause notice or a single composite assessment order for more than one assessment or financial year would adversely affect a registered person’s rights under Section 128 of the Andhra Pradesh GST Act as well as the statutory right to file appeals against assessment orders passed under Sections 73 or 74.
